Technical Service Bulletins for the 2000 BMW E37
has issued 1 technical service bulletin (TSBs) for the 2000 BMW E37.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.
240500 — POWER TRAIN:A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ION
CUSTOMERS MAY COMPLAIN ABOUT ERRATIC/HARSH SHIFTING AND THE TRANSMISSION LIGHT IS ILLUMINATED AND NO START/NO CRANK CONDITION. *TT
